1. Cells and Organelles | 细胞与细胞器

Cell membrane – the thin, flexible outer layer that controls what enters and leaves the cell. Trick: imagine a ‘bouncer’ at a club, only letting approved substances pass.

细胞膜 – 控制物质进出细胞的薄而柔韧的外层。窍门:想象俱乐部门口的“保镖”,只允许获准的物质通过。

Nucleus – the control centre containing DNA. Trick: link ‘nucleus’ to ‘nerve centre’ – it’s the boss of the cell, giving all the orders.

细胞核 – 含有 DNA 的控制中心。窍门:把“nucleus”和“神经中枢”联系起来——它是细胞的老板,发号施令。

Mitochondria (singular: mitochondrion) – the ‘powerhouses’ that release energy through respiration. Trick: think ‘mighty‑chondria’ – they pack a mighty energy punch, like tiny batteries.

线粒体 – 通过呼吸作用释放能量的“发电站”。窍门:联成“强力‑chondria”——它们像小电池一样提供强力能量。

Chloroplast – found only in plant cells, contains chlorophyll for photosynthesis. Trick: ‘chloro’ means green, ‘plast’ like plastic container – green containers that turn sunlight into food.

叶绿体 – 仅存在植物细胞中,含叶绿素进行光合作用。窍门:“chloro”意为绿色,“plast”像塑料容器——把阳光变成食物的绿色容器。

Vacuole – a large sap‑filled space in plant cells that maintains turgor pressure. Trick: imagine a water balloon inside the cell – full of liquid to keep the cell stiff.

液泡 – 植物细胞内充满细胞液的大空腔,维持膨压。窍门:想象细胞内的水气球——充满液体使细胞坚挺。


2. Tissues, Organs and Systems | 组织、器官与系统

Tissue – a group of similar cells working together, e.g. muscle tissue. Trick: consider tissues as ‘teams’ of identical workers; each team does one job.

组织 – 一组相似细胞共同工作,如肌肉组织。窍门:将组织看作由相同员工组成的“团队”;每个团队完成一项任务。

Organ – made of different tissues, performing a specific function, e.g. the heart. Trick: an organ is like a department in a factory, combining several skills to produce one result.

器官 – 由不同组织构成,执行特定功能,如心脏。窍门:器官就像工厂的车间,结合多种技能输出一个结果。

Organ system – a group of organs working together, e.g. the digestive system. Trick: systems are entire production lines, linking departments to make a final product (digested food, in this case).

器官系统 – 一组协同工作的器官,如消化系统。窍门:系统是整条生产线,连接各个部门以制造最终产品(此处为消化的食物)。

Differentiation – the process by which a cell becomes specialised. Trick: think of students ‘differentiating’ into specialists – one becomes a doctor, another an engineer, all from the same basic training.

分化 – 细胞变得特化的过程。窍门:想象学生“分化”成专家——一个成了医生,另一个成了工程师,都来自相同的基础培训。


3. Nutrition and Digestion | 营养与消化

Balanced diet – intake of all nutrients in correct proportions. Trick: picture a ‘balanced plate’ with carbs, protein, fats, vitamins, minerals, fibre and water, like a rainbow on your plate.

均衡膳食 – 按正确比例摄入所有营养素。窍门:想象“均衡餐盘”,包含碳水化合物、蛋白质、脂肪、维生素、矿物质、纤维和水,像盘中的彩虹。

Enzyme – a biological catalyst that speeds up reactions without being used up. Trick: think of enzymes as tiny ‘keys’ fitting specific ‘locks’ (substrates), unlocking reactions quickly.

– 生物催化剂,加速反应而自身不被消耗。窍门:将酶想象成小“钥匙”契合特定的“锁”(底物),迅速开启反应。

Peristalsis – wave‑like muscle contractions that push food along the alimentary canal. Trick: pronounce it as ‘peri‑stall‑sis’ and picture a snake swallowing its prey, squeezing it down the tube.

蠕动 – 将食物沿消化道推进的波浪状肌肉收缩。窍门:发音联想“peri‑stall‑sis”,想象蛇吞猎物时挤压食道的画面。

Villus (plural: villi) – tiny finger‑like projections in the small intestine that absorb nutrients. Trick: villi look like the fingers of a glove, massively increasing surface area for absorption.

绒毛 – 小肠内微小的指状突起,吸收养分。窍门:绒毛像手套的手指,大幅增加吸收的表面积。


4. Breathing and Gas Exchange | 呼吸与气体交换

Alveoli (singular: alveolus) – microscopic air sacs in the lungs where gas exchange occurs. Trick: imagine a bunch of grapes, each grape is an alveolus, providing a huge surface area for O₂ and CO₂ to swap.

肺泡 – 肺内进行气体交换的微型气囊。窍门:想象一串葡萄,每颗葡萄是一个肺泡,提供了巨大的表面积让氧气和二氧化碳交换。

Diaphragm – a dome‑shaped muscle that flattens to draw air into the lungs. Trick: think of a plunger – when you push it down, space opens up and fluid is drawn in.

横膈膜 – 穹顶状肌肉,变扁平时将空气吸入肺部。窍门:想象一个皮搋子——压下时隔膜打开空间,空气被吸入。

Ventilation – the movement of air into and out of the lungs. Trick: link ‘ventilation’ to ‘vent’ – opening a vent lets fresh air in. It’s not breathing, it’s the mechanical part.

通气 – 空气进出肺部的运动。窍门:把“ventilation”和“vent(通风口)”联系起来——打开通风口让新鲜空气进入。这不是呼吸,而是机械运动。


5. Circulatory System | 循环系统

Artery – a thick‑walled blood vessel that carries blood away from the heart (usually oxygenated). Trick: ‘A’ for artery, ‘A’ for away – arteries take blood away from the heart. Walls are thick to withstand high pressure.

动脉 – 管壁较厚的血管,将血液带离心脏(通常含氧血)。窍门:“A”代表 artery、“A”代表 away(离开)——动脉把血液带离心脏。管壁厚以承受高压。

Vein – a thin‑walled vessel that returns blood to the heart, containing valves to prevent backflow. Trick: veins are ‘vulnerable’, thin‑walled, and have ‘doors’ (valves) to keep blood moving one way.

静脉 – 管壁薄,将血液送回心脏,含有瓣膜防止倒流。窍门:静脉(vein)很脆弱(vulnerable),管壁薄,且有“门”(瓣膜)确保血液单向流动。

Capillary – a microscopic vessel where substances are exchanged with tissues. Trick: capillaries are ‘capillary‑size’ – as thin as a hair, with walls just one cell thick for easy diffusion.

毛细血管 – 与组织交换物质的微小血管。窍门:毛细血管(capillary)如头发(hair)般细,管壁仅一个细胞厚,便于扩散。

Plasma – the liquid part of blood that transports cells, nutrients, hormones and waste. Trick: plasma is like the river water that carries boats (cells) and cargo.

血浆 – 血液的液体部分,运输细胞、营养、激素和废物。窍门:血浆像河流的水,运载船只(细胞)和货物。


6. Nervous System and Hormones | 神经系统与激素

Neuron (nerve cell) – a specialised cell that transmits electrical impulses. Trick: think of a ‘neon’ sign lighting up in sequence – impulses race along neurons like electricity through a wire.

神经元(神经细胞)– 传递电信号的特化细胞。窍门:想象“霓虹灯”依次亮起——脉冲沿神经元狂奔,像电流通过电线。

Synapse – the gap between neurons where chemical messengers cross. Trick: ‘synapse’ sounds like ‘sin‑gap’ – a tiny gap that signals must jump across using neurotransmitters.

突触 – 神经元之间的间隙,化学信使在此传递。窍门:“synapse”听起来像“sin‑gap” – 一个小间隙,信号必须借助神经递质跳过去。

Reflex arc – a rapid, automatic response pathway that bypasses the brain. Trick: think of a ‘reflex’ as a shortcut – the spinal cord handles it before the brain even notices, like a knee‑jerk reaction.

反射弧 – 绕过大脑的快速自动反应通路。窍门:把“反射”想象成捷径——脊髓在脑注意到之前就处理了,如膝跳反应。

Hormone – a chemical messenger transported in the blood to target organs. Trick: ‘hormone’ sounds like ‘harmony’ – they help maintain body harmony, like a conductor’s baton signalling different players.

激素 – 通过血液运输到靶器官的化学信使。窍门:“hormone”谐音“harmony”——它们维持身体和谐,如指挥棒向不同乐手发出信号。


7. Reproduction | 生殖

Gamete – a sex cell (sperm or egg) with half the normal chromosome number. Trick: ‘gamete’ sounds like ‘game it’ – reproduction is a game of passing half your chromosomes.

配子 – 具有正常染色体数一半的性细胞(精子或卵子)。窍门:“gamete” 联想 “game it” – 生殖就是传递一半染色体的游戏。

Fertilisation – fusion of male and female gametes to form a zygote. Trick: think of fertilisation as a ‘key and lock’ – sperm unlocks the egg to restore full chromosome set.

受精 – 雄性和雌性配子融合形成受精卵。窍门:想象受精为“钥匙和锁” – 精子打开卵子以恢复全套染色体。

Placenta – organ that allows exchange of nutrients and waste between mother and fetus. Trick: the placenta is a ‘life‑line belt’ – a disc where mother’s blood and baby’s blood come close but don’t mix.

胎盘 – 允许母体和胎儿交换营养和废物的器官。窍门:胎盘是“生命传送带”——母血和胎儿血靠近但不混合的圆盘。


8. Inheritance and Genetics | 遗传与遗传学

Gene – a section of DNA that codes for a protein. Trick: think of a gene as a ‘recipe’ in a cookbook (DNA); each recipe makes one protein dish.

基因 – 编码蛋白质的一段 DNA。窍门:把基因看作食谱书(DNA)中的一份“食谱”;每份食谱烹饪一道蛋白质菜肴。

Allele – different version of the same gene. Trick: alleles are ‘alternatives’ – like different flavours of the same recipe, e.g. blue eyes vs brown eyes.

等位基因 – 同一基因的不同版本。窍门:等位基因是“选择项”——相同食谱的不同口味,如蓝眼与棕眼。

Dominant / Recessive – a dominant allele always shows its effect, recessive only when two copies are present. Trick: dominant = ‘bossy’ twin who always wins, recessive = ‘shy’ twin who only appears when alone.

显性 / 隐性 – 显性等位基因总能表现,隐性仅在有两个拷贝时才表现。窍门:显性 = 专横的双胞胎总是赢,隐性 = 害羞的双胞胎只有独处时才露面。

Genotype / Phenotype – genotype is the allele combination, phenotype is the appearance. Trick: ‘genotype’ = ‘gene‑type’ (the code), ‘phenotype’ = ‘photo‑type’ (the picture you see).

基因型 / 表型 – 基因型是等位基因组合,表型是外观。窍门:“genotype” = “基因类型”(代码),“phenotype” = “照片类型”(你看到的样子)。


9. Ecology and Ecosystems | 生态学与生态系统

Species – a group of organisms that can interbreed to produce fertile offspring. Trick: ‘species’ sounds like ‘special breed’ – a group that only breeds successfully with its own kind.

物种 – 能够相互交配并产生可育后代的一群生物。窍门:“species” 联想“special breed” – 只能与同类成功繁殖的特殊种群。

Population – all members of one species living in an area. Trick: ‘population’ = ‘people’‑lation – count every individual of that one species in the habitat.

种群 – 居住在同一区域同一物种的所有个体。窍门:“population” 想象成“people”‑lation – 数一数栖息地中该物种的每个个体。

Food web – a network of interconnected food chains. Trick: a food web is like the ‘web’ of a spider – many threads linking feeding relationships together, not just one straight line.

食物网 – 相互关联的食物链组成的网络。窍门:食物网像蜘蛛的“网”——许多线将摄食关系连在一起,而非一条直线。

Decomposer – an organism that breaks down dead matter, e.g. fungi and bacteria. Trick: ‘de‑composer’ means ‘to break apart’ – they decompose complex materials into simple ones, nature’s recyclers.

分解者 – 分解死物质的生物,如真菌和细菌。窍门:“de‑composer”意为“分解”——它们将复杂物质分解为简单物质,大自然的回收者。


10. Key Processes: Photosynthesis and Respiration | 关键过程:光合作用与呼吸作用

Photosynthesis – the process by which plants use sunlight to convert CO₂ and H₂O into glucose and O₂. The equation: 6CO₂ + 6H₂O → C₆H₁₂O₆ + 6O₂. Trick: ‘photo’ = light, ‘synthesis’ = putting together – using light to build sugar.

光合作用 – 植物利用阳光将二氧化碳和水转化为葡萄糖和氧气的过程。方程式:6CO₂ + 6H₂O → C₆H₁₂O₆ + 6O₂。窍门:“photo” = 光,“synthesis” = 合成——用光来制造糖。

Respiration – the chemical reaction in cells that releases energy from glucose, often summarised as: C₆H₁₂O₆ + 6O₂ → 6CO₂ + 6H₂O. Trick: respiration is the opposite of photosynthesis; think of it as ‘burning’ sugar for energy in your body’s engine.

呼吸作用 – 细胞中从葡萄糖释放能量的化学反应,常概括为:C₆H₁₂O₆ + 6O₂ → 6CO₂ + 6H₂O。窍门:呼吸作用是光合作用的逆向过程;想象成身体引擎“燃烧”糖分获取能量。

Diffusion – net movement of particles from a region of high concentration to low concentration. Trick: imagine a crowd spreading out from a packed room – they naturally drift to empty spaces.

扩散 – 粒子从高浓度区域向低浓度区域的净运动。窍门:想象人群从拥挤的房间散开——自然飘向空旷之处。

Osmosis – diffusion of water across a partially permeable membrane. Trick: ‘osmosis’ sounds like ‘oh‑slow‑sis’ – water seeping slowly through a coffee filter, from where there’s more water to where there’s less.

渗透 – 水通过部分渗透膜的扩散。窍门:“osmosis” 谐音“哦‑慢‑渗”——水像通过咖啡滤纸慢慢渗过,从水多的地方到水少的地方。
